With his contract due to expire in June 2025, Pep Guardiola has yet to clarify his future with Manchester City. The Spanish coach, an emblematic figure at the Skyblues since his arrival in 2016, is maintaining the mystery and leaving his managers in suspense. The situation could come to a head in the run-up to the festive season.

In a downward spiral ahead of the international break, with Manchester City on a four-match winless run, Pep Guardiola is causing his managers to lose patience. According to Relevo, Hugo Viana, the club’s future sporting director from next summer, wants to know as soon as possible whether or not the Catalan coach will extend his contract. Despite this impatience, no explicit pressure has been exerted on the Catalan tactician. However, time is running out, and a decision is expected around Christmas, ideally before the Premier League’s famous Boxing Day.

Manchester City’s current situation further complicates Pep Guardiola‘s future. The Skyblues are going through a difficult period, marked by an unprecedented run of four consecutive defeats. Never since he took over at the Etihad Stadium has the 53-year-old coach experienced such a run of bad form. The Catalan is now faced with the task of quickly finding solutions to turn the team around, and this could influence his thinking on his future. Guardiola, who has won five Premier League titles with City, could be tempted to take on a new challenge, especially as his initial contract was extended in 2020 for a further five years, already an exception in his career.

Implicit pressure from Manchester City for a swift response

On the part of Manchester City’s directors, the urgency has not yet been officially declared, but the timing is becoming critical. Hugo Viana, who will replace Txiki Begiristain as sporting director, will have the onerous task of planning the club’s long-term future. To do this, he needs to know whether Guardiola will continue his adventure or whether a transition will be necessary. Boxing Day, a key period in the English calendar, could become a symbolic deadline for clarifying the situation. A late response from Guardiola could disrupt preparations for next season, especially if the club has to look for a high-profile replacement.

Should Pep Guardiola decide to leave, Manchester City would face a major challenge in finding a coach capable of carrying on the Spaniard’s legacy and success. A number of names could be floated around, but none at present seems capable of guaranteeing the same stability and exceptional results achieved during the Guardiola era. If not, a contract extension could reassure the players and fans, but it would also raise the question of the coach’s ability to renew his methods after almost a decade at the helm.
